What Are Loans No Credit Check?

First off, loans no credit check are exactly what they sound like. These are loans where lenders don’t look at your credit history when deciding whether to approve you. Sounds great, right? But there’s more to it.

Common Myths About Loans No Credit Check

Myth 1: Everyone Can Get Them

A popular belief is that anyone can snag these loans. While it’s true that lenders might not check your credit, they still want to know if you can pay them back. That means they might look at other factors like your income or employment status.

Myth 2: They’re Always the Best Option

Some folks think loans no credit check are the easiest and most reliable choice. But keep in mind, they often come with higher interest rates. This is the lender’s way of managing their risk. If you’re not careful, you could end up paying a lot more than you planned.

Myth 3: They’re Unregulated

Another common misconception is that all loans no credit check are shady. Sure, there are some bad apples out there, but many are offered by legitimate lenders. Just like any loan, it’s crucial to do your research. Look for reviews and check the lender’s reputation before you sign anything.

Realities of Loans No Credit Check

Fact 1: Fast Approval

One of the perks of loans no credit check is that they often have quicker approval times. If you need cash fast, this can be a lifesaver. You might get your money the same day or within a few days.

Fact 2: Use for Emergency Needs

These loans can be helpful for urgent situations like medical bills or car repairs. If cash flow is tight, this could be a sensible option. Just remember to pay it back on time to avoid further issues.

Fact 3: Help Build Credit

Surprisingly, some lenders report your payment history to credit bureaus. So, if you make your payments on time, you could improve your credit score over time. That’s a win-win, right?

Things to Consider

Before jumping into loans no credit check, think about what you really need. Do you have a plan to pay it back? If not, you might want to explore other options. A standard loan with a credit check could offer lower rates and better terms in the long run.

Also, weigh the total cost of borrowing. What will the interest and fees look like over time? It’s not just about getting money now; it’s about handling it smartly.
